     "Brentwood's Ward" by Michelle Griep is a stand alone novel, and my first my this author.  "Brentwood's Ward" was the top book the Amazon recommended for me for several weeks, plus it came recommended by a favorite author of mine.  Thus, I decided to look into it, and was able to get an ARC.

     Emily Payne is a little bit spoiled.  Her father isn't very attentive to her, and she spends her time (and her father's money) shopping and going to various parties, vying for a husband.  Her father decides to hire someone to guard her while he goes out of town on a business trip, but she is very rebellious to the idea.

     Nicholas Brentwood has his hands full with a murderer on the loose, shady business surrounding Mr. Payne, and his sickly sister.  How is he supposed to chase Emily from party to party, and fight his growing attraction to her?

     I also would recommend this book! The setting was very interesting, and the characters drew you in.  I will keep an eye this author for sure!
